Hotel Xaloc Playa
8.6 (50 reviews)

Hotel Xaloc Playa ★★★

📍 Major, 21, Punta Prima

"We arrived at lunchtime and the lady on reception was very welcoming and we were soon checked in and unpacking our bags. We had a room towards the rear of the hotel overlooking the garden , crazy golf and pool. You could see the sun rising in the morning. Steep steps to the top floor , no lifts at this part of the hotel. Room was comfortable with a large bathroom and shower. My only complaint was the bed was on wheels and moved across the room when you sat up to read , as the floor is tiled . A few beer mats helped to solve the problem . The food in restaurant was buffet style and very enjoyable with a good choice . Staff helpful and kept on top of cleaning tables. Pool bar very reasonable prices for food and drink. Three nights of entertainment while we were there , a trio , a duo with flamenco dancer and a solo artist. The hotel is very clean and well maintained. A clean beach with soft sand just across the road, lifeguards on duty also . Would definitely return in the future"

Seth Punta Prima ★★★★
"Check-in was straightforward, and the lady on reception was lovely and welcoming. The lack of air conditioning was a major issue. There was no A/C in the lobby, it had been broken in the restaurant all week, and there was none in the evening entertainment areas. With temperatures consistently in the mid-30s, this really needs addressing. Our adjoining family room made a brilliant first impression. It was spacious, clean, and having two bathrooms was a real bonus. Unfortunately, both showers were unusable as the water constantly fluctuated from scalding hot to freezing cold without warning, and the water pressure was very poor. We reported this to reception and were assured it had been fixed, despite us being in the room all evening. It definitely hadn’t been. When we raised it again, we were simply told there wasn’t a problem and the receptionist shrugged it off. We spent the entire week unable to use the showers properly and had to rely on the shallow bath for our family of five. On a positive note, the kettle in our room didn’t work initially, but it was replaced quickly. The food was okay but very average for an all-inclusive hotel. We actually chose to eat out on two evenings, and there are some excellent restaurants along the beachfront. There were no themed nights, and the menu was largely the same every day with only minor variations. By the end of the week, we were really struggling with the lack of choice, and I wouldn’t consider us a particularly fussy family. The drinks system was probably our biggest frustration. On arrival, you’re given a card which has to be exchanged every time you want a drink in a plastic cup. This makes your all-inclusive wristband feel completely pointless. We found the whole system inconvenient and unnecessary, and it’s one of the main reasons we wouldn’t return. The pool snack bar was also disappointing. It mainly offered a few biscuits and pre-made sandwiches from a small hatch. Burgers and hot dogs could be ordered, but we tried them once and found them inedible. The pools themselves were lovely and very warm, which our children really enjoyed. The splash area was excellent. However, the sloped entrance into the shallow end of one of the pools was extremely slippery and could be a safety concern. Sunbeds were another issue, with most being reserved by towels before 10am, so finding one later in the day was almost impossible. The beach was beautiful and only a short walk away, which was definitely one of the highlights of the holiday. The location is excellent, being only around 20 minutes from the airport and close to plenty of restaurants and shops. The only downside was the number of mosquitoes in the evenings. Overall, we wouldn’t return to this hotel because of the drinks system, repetitive food, broken air conditioning, and unresolved shower issues. It’s a shame, because the location is fantastic and, without those problems, we would happily have considered coming back."
